Worth grading only if it gems
A PSA 10 Donpa, Marksman Fur Hire DASA-EN014 brings $41.00 versus $1.49 raw — a $39.51 spread that covers an economy-tier ~$25 grading fee. A PSA 9 ($9.00) only about breaks even after fees, so the case rests on gemming.

Break-even by outcome and fee
| If it comes back… | Sells for | Economy / bulk (~$25.00) | Standard (~$50.00) | Express (~$150) |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Gem — PSA 10 | $41.00 | +$14.51 | −$10.49 | −$110 |
| PSA 9 | $9.00 | −$17.49 | −$42.49 | −$142 |
| PSA 8 | $8.32 | −$18.17 | −$43.17 | −$143 |
Net = sale price − $1.49 raw value − fee. Fee tiers are illustrative; plug your grader's current price into the calculator below.

Which grader pays the most — and what a 10 takes
All centering standards →| Grader | 10 sells for | vs best | Front centering for a 10 | Back |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| BGS 10 | $53.00 | best | 55/45 | 70/30 |
| PSA 10 | $41.00 | −$12.00 | 55/45 | 75/25 |
| CGC 10 | $25.00 | −$28.00 | 55/45 | 75/25 |
| SGC 10 | $25.00 | −$28.00 | 55/45 | 75/25 |
Tolerances are each company's published centering standard for its top grade; surface, corners and edges must also be clean. Centering is the one you can measure yourself before you pay.
